Phú Thọ ( Vietnamese pronunciation: [fǔ t̺ʰɔ̂ˀ]) is a province in northern Vietnam. Its administration center Việt Trì ward is located 80 kilometres (50 mi) from Hanoi and 50 kilometres (31 mi) from Nội Bài International Airport. The province covers an area of 9,631.38 km (3,718.70 mi) and, as of 2025, it had a population of 4,022,638.
